King Promise and Mr Eazi just dropped a fire new track called “THAT WAY.” This smooth Afrofusion banger hit the airwaves on February 6, 2026. It leads their upcoming joint album See What We’ve Done, set to arrive in March.
King Promise brings his signature Ghanaian highlife vibes and silky vocals. Mr Eazi adds that laid-back Nigerian Afro-pop charm. Together, these two African heavyweights create pure magic. Their chemistry feels effortless, built from years of friendship and past collabs.
The producers GuiltyBeatz and JAE5 handle the beat. GuiltyBeatz delivers rich, warm production known from hits with Beyoncé and Tems. JAE5 adds crisp energy from work with Burna Boy and Dave. They flip a classic Backstreet Boys melody into something fresh. Nostalgia hits hard, yet the rhythm stays modern and addictive.
The song itself tells a simple love story. It’s all about that one person who drives you wild. Lines like “Wetin you dey do me nobody can come close” capture raw devotion. The vibe mixes emotion with danceable grooves. Heartfelt lyrics meet thumping percussion. It feels familiar yet brand new.
